Abstract
A time-of-flight LiDAR is demonstrated using a single soliton frequency comb generated in an ultrahigh-Q silica microresonator. Utilizing an electro-optic sampling Sagnac interferometer, distance measurement with 8-nm precision at 1-km range is achieved.
